Funeral for Greg Westmoreland, 40, of Hartselle was Tuesday, May 5, at 11:00 a.m. at Peck Funeral Home with Wayne Cobb officiating.
Burial was in Johnson Chapel Cemetery.
Mr. Westmoreland died Sunday, May 3, 1998, at his residence. He was a native of Texas and a member of Neel Church of Christ. He was a machine operator at Copeland Corporation.
He is survived by one son, Brandon Westmoreland of Decatur; one daughter, Lindsey Westmoreland of Hartselle; his father and stepmother, Cleo and Diane Westmoreland of Hartselle; his stepfather, Luke Anders of Hartselle; two brothers, Chris Westmoreland of Hartselle and Bobby Anders of Falkville; two sisters, Amanda Farmer and Yvonne Sparkman, both of Hartselle; one stepbrother, Keith Anders of Hartselle; and his grandmother, Eva Kirby of Hartselle.
Pallbearers were Danny Slaten, Kevin Slaten, Shannon Kirby, Heath Kirby, Dustin Sparkmen and Jeff Young.
